Ispa’s bachelor’s degree in Basic Education combines up-to-date multidisciplinary theoretical and practical knowledge with curricular placements throughout all years of the programme. This consistent and well-balanced training, together with rigorous work habits in the fields of educational research and planning, provides a solid foundation for the training of future Early Childhood Educators and Primary School Teachers.
This is one of the courses born out of the partnership between ISPA and ESEI Maria Ulrich (2014-2020), creating a training programme that brings together the knowledge of both institutions, expanding and strengthening it.
In addition to the teaching activities that take place at Ispa, some complementary activities are held at Casa das Expressões, in Penedo.
Note: This bachelor’s degree constitutes the first stage towards professional qualification as an Early Childhood Educator and as a teacher for the 1st and 2nd cycles of Basic Education.
